A few groups I've worked with were dealing with (non-OST) a team building situation (aka deep conflict in the group - in this case a large portion was gender conflict). I asked the group to introduce themselves by bringing their grandmother or grandfather to the circle and share a story. By the completion of the circle, everyone laughed (a few cried) and relaxed - they wouldn't let me as the facilitator get away without sharing one too. This question came to me through a group of Elders. Whenever we met, they gave me the amazing gift of relating a story from a grandparent or great-grandparent, grounding me in the past and present — and I want to recognize and honor the Elder's wisdom here.
